Fountain-Fort Carson was not able to break out of their rough patch on Friday as the team picked up their third straight loss. They fell victim to a tough 16-4 defeat at the hands of the Rampart Rams. Fountain-Fort Carson was given a dose of their own medicine in this game as Rampart ap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in May of 2023.
Trystan Freeman was cooking despite his team's loss, scoring three runs and stealing two bases while going 2-for-3. Joe Baumbach was another key contributor, going 2-for-3 with two stolen bases and an RBI.
On Rampart's side, Liam Martin was a major factor no matter where he played. He struck out seven batters over 5.2 innings while giving up four earned runs off seven hits. Martin has been nothing but reliable on the mound: he hasn't pitched less than five innings in four consecutive pitching appearances. Martin was also solid in the batter's box, scoring a run while going 2-for-3.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Justus Derickson, who got on base in all five of his plate appearances with four RBI, two runs, and a double. Another player making a difference was David Eastman, who scored three runs and stole two bases while getting on base in three of his five plate appearances.
Fountain-Fort Carson's defeat dropped their record down to 3-5. As for Rampart, the victory was the fourth in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 7-4.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Fountain-Fort Carson will challenge Pine Creek at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Pine Creek is strutting in with some hitting muscle, as they've averaged 10 runs per game this season. As for Rampart, they are on the road again on Tuesday to play Vista Ridge at 4:00 p.m.
